
TortoiseGit使用教程:从基础到进阶

"TortoiseGit日常使用指南,涵盖了创建新库、添加文件及文件夹、创建分支、查看分支情况及修改日志、比较版本差异、合并分支以及Stash和忽略文件等操作。"
TortoiseGit是一款基于Git的图形化界面工具,专为Windows用户设计。它提供了一个友好的用户界面,使得Git的日常使用变得更加简单。TortoiseGit的使用指南通常会包括以下关键知识点:
1. **安装**
在安装TortoiseGit之前,需要先安装msysGit,这是Git在Windows上的运行环境。你可以从http://code.google.com/p/msysgit/ 下载最新版本,并在安装时选择"Checkout as-is, commit as-is"以保持文件的原始换行风格。接着安装TortoiseGit,可以从相同源获取。
2. **创建新库**
创建新的Git仓库非常简单,只需在你想要管理的文件夹上右键,选择“Git Create Repository here”即可。这将在该文件夹下创建一个.git隐藏目录,用于存储所有版本控制信息。
3. **添加文件和文件夹**
将文件或文件夹纳入版本控制,右键点击它们并选择“Add”,然后进行提交(Commit)以保存更改。
4. **创建分支**
分支管理是Git的核心特性之一。在TortoiseGit中,通过“Branch/Tag”菜单创建新分支,然后可以切换分支(Checkout)以进行独立开发。
5. **查看分支情况及修改日志**
使用“Log”视图可以查看每个分支的历史记录,包括提交的详细信息、作者、日期和提交消息。这对于追踪代码的演变过程非常有用。
6. **比较版本差异**
“Diff”工具允许你比较不同版本之间的文件或目录差异。这有助于理解每次提交带来的具体变化。
7. **合并分支**
当在不同的分支上完成工作后,可以使用“Merge”功能将改动合并回主分支或其他分支。这有助于团队协作和代码整合。
8. **Stash**
Stash功能允许你在不提交的情况下暂存更改。当你需要切换到另一个分支但当前的工作未完成时,可以使用“Stash Changes”来保存进度,之后再恢复。
9. **忽略文件**
可以通过创建一个名为.gitignore的文件来指定哪些文件或文件类型不应被Git跟踪。这有助于保持仓库的整洁,避免不必要的文件进入版本控制。
除此之外,虽然本文不涉及Git服务器设置、推送版本到服务器、从其他机器拉取版本或解决中文字符问题,但在实际开发中,这些也是TortoiseGit用户需要掌握的重要操作。对于深入学习,推荐阅读《ProGit》和TortoiseGit的帮助文档。
TortoiseGit为Windows用户提供了强大的Git集成,使得版本控制更加直观和高效,是开发过程中不可或缺的工具。
相关推荐










wofeiguo2012
- 粉丝: 0
最新资源
- 图解SQLServer2000基础操作教程详解
- 掌握VB高级程序设计的核心技巧与实例讲解
- PB实现的QQ和RTX消息自动化发送工具
- 全面解析Spring.NET框架的中文参考文档
- TrayTool:一键隐藏托盘图标实用工具
- 软件开发计划书模板使用指南与各阶段文档要点
- C#实现的32k高精度计时器源码解析
- 源码分享:DELPHI编写的EXE加壳工具
- 探索IBM RAP技术:配置与开发环境解析
- C#实现基础运算的简单计算器设计
- JMock开发包及文档资源下载
- NEHE图形教程SDK与框架源码分析
- C#学习手册:多媒体教学与分卷压缩指南
- MX COMPONENT:三菱PLC开发组件的使用与通讯细节简化
- C#源码实现:数据方法界面分离的计算器程序
- 自制个性化铃声工具:轻松剪辑MP3片段
- 深入解析Cisco CCNA/CCNP教材中的关键概念与协议
- 精选办公网页设计图标素材下载
- Xerces-J-bin.2.9.1压缩包下载指南
- Struts文件上传入门实例分析
- C#航班查询系统实战教程
- 开发完整的c# .Net网上书店系统教程
- 全面支持CSF格式的多功能播放器
- 一元多项式与哈夫曼树:数据结构课程设计深度解析